The ancestor of China goldfish is the wild red crucian carp hundreds of years ago, which was first seen in the releasing pond in Jiaxing, Zhejiang Province in the early Northern Song Dynasty. 1 163, Emperor Zhao Gou of the Southern Song Dynasty raised a large number of golden crucian carp in the palace. Family-raised goldfish spread from the palace to the people and gradually spread. The domestication of goldfish has gone through two stages: pond culture and pot culture. After careful selection by several generations of folk artists, the single-tailed goldfish gradually developed into two-tailed, three-tailed and four-tailed goldfish, and the color gradually changed from a single red to red and white, five flowers, black, blue and purple. Its shape has also changed from a long and narrow spindle to an oval and spherical shape, and its variety has changed from a single golden crucian carp to today's rich and colorful. Japanese koi's original species is red carp, which was introduced to Japan from China in the early days. After careful cultivation by the Japanese people, it has gradually become one of the world-famous ornamental fish. The main varieties in japanese koi are red and white, Showa tricolor, Dazheng tricolor and Qiu Cui.
